Transaction 5a51edab63ec574767be7ffca8142430324eaee5e31b10363d800a7647d3d059
1 Input
1 Output
-
5a51edab63ec574767be7ffca8142430324eaee5e31b10363d800a7647d3d059:0
- value
- 1467862
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d081242aad256735b95adb59665149ba823942e
- address
- bc1q95ypys426ft8xku44k6eveg5nw5z89pw9mu5s2